Company Summary
Drowning in email? TALKLER – Email for your Ears is the only mobile platform for eyes-free, reads-aloud-to-you, voice-controlled productivity + safety—starting with email. For overwhelmed professionals worldwide, as well as blind, physically challenged, reading-impaired users, and safety-conscious drivers. Email, calendar, docs, news + more. Advertisers get breakthrough ads with verified emails, unprecedented mindshare + massive click-thru.
